First off, you can still use the original device that found the base - just use YOUR email address to create the account to add the system to. The system isn't tied to the device, it's tied to the account credentials.

 

You haven't given us a lot of information about the devices used (OS level, specific device) and what you tried to get them to see the base initially. That could be a clue as to why some didn't work while one did. Were all devices on your WiFi when trying to set up? I know you said you tried everything but we have no idea what that even means.

 

As BRH said, and you reiterated, a system that has been set up has to have all devices removed from Settings, My Devices in the previous account. I would also hold the base reset button until the LEDs flash amber. After the base reboots, you should have green power and Internet LEDs - if not, nothing is going to work. Using the new account, claim the base using Add Device. You can then sync the cameras, being sure to only briefly press the base sync button.

 

The more details you provide, the better the suggestions can be.

Just so you know, v2.7.1 is the app version which has nothing to do with the firmware version on the cameras and base.

 

Since she can still manipulate the system, it hasn't been removed from her account. Deleting the app won't do a thing - you have to use the app to go into Settings, My Devicees, select each device, starting with the cameras, and use the Remove Device button at the bottom. Continue with the cameras and then the base. Only then will anyone else be able to do anything with the system. I know you said you've already done that but the system is still working so something has been missed.
